Dr. Hanné Becker obtained her DMA (Doctor of Musical Arts) degree in Organ Performance in the studio of Prof. Kevin Komisaruk at the University of Toronto. Her doctoral thesis focused on the highly imaginative, virtuosic organ music of composer Matthias Weckmann (1616 – 1674), laying the groundwork for a new performer’s edition.
She has an extensive International Concert and liturgical background: active as soloist, accompanist, choral conductor, improviser, composer and singer. She especially loves communicating with her audiences, and sharing the transformative power of music. Hanné also taught music as a Graduate Teaching Assistant in the Music Theory Department at the Faculty of Music, University of Toronto from 2018 - 2020. In 2024 she launched the YouTube Channel called The-Art-of-Organ-Playing.
